Broadcom will host its annual Network Observability Virtual Summit on September 10, 2024. The summit will delve deep into the evolving landscape of network observability, offering insights, best practices, strategies and innovative solutions for today’s complex network environments.
The theme of this year’s summit is Connectivity in Concert, where all elements of the network work in concert to deliver the best connected experiences for users. With the challenges presented by a constantly changing network landscape, network observability is a top priority for enterprise organizations. Network observability can bring together insights about complete end-to-end network paths so that your organization can understand, operate, and transform complex heterogeneous networks while safeguarding network and user experiences.
This three-hour event will feature valuable insights and real-world successes from some of today’s leading enterprises who are establishing game-changing network observability as they evolve and optimize their network infrastructure to deliver business value. We’ll also take a look at the state of the art of network observability for cloud, edge, enterprise network infrastructures, and more from Google Cloud and Broadcom experts.
